A language of Chad

goy
30 (1998).
Tandjilé region: Kélo and Lai subprefectures, Goundo-Bengli, Goundo-Nangom, and Goundo-Yila villages.
Southwestern Chad
8a (Moribund).
Niger-Congo, Atlantic-Congo, Volta-Congo, North, Adamawa-Ubangi, Adamawa, Mbum-Day, Kim
None known. Lexical similarity: 60% with Besmé [bes], 51% with Kim [kia].
Older adults only. Shifted to Kabalai [kvf]. Also use Nancere [nnc].
Unwritten [Qaax].
